Mixpanel
enterpriseEvent-based analytics platform measuring user engagement and retention through behavioral cohorting.
Automation workflows that trigger from analytics conditions on funnels, retention, and segments using Mixpanel signals.
Mixpanel’s core workflow centers on defining an event taxonomy, sending events with consistent event properties, and analyzing those events through funnels, path analysis, and cohort retention curves. Identity handling supports anonymous-to-known resolution so analysts can compare behavior before and after sign-in and segment users by identification state. The system also offers automation that triggers actions from behavioral conditions, which reduces manual triage when conversion or retention shifts. Governance improves when teams enforce event naming conventions and property presence for analytics stability.
A key tradeoff is that correct funnel and retention outputs depend on disciplined client and server event instrumentation, including stable event property schemas and accurate user identification events. Mixpanel fits teams that already treat analytics events as production inputs and need continuous monitoring plus API-driven integration to keep data consistent across apps. It also works best when analysts plan automation rules and segmentation logic with a known event taxonomy instead of ad hoc one-off queries.

Pendo
enterpriseProduct experience platform integrating behavioral analytics with in-app user guidance and feedback.
In-app experiences are driven directly by Pendo segment rules, letting behavior conditions trigger contextual UI.
Pendo provides event collection and analytics with funnels, path exploration, and cohort retention views that connect to feature adoption goals. In-app experiences are managed through targeted tooltips, guides, and feedback components that can be driven by segment membership. Identity resolution connects anonymous visitors to known users so adoption can be tracked across sessions and accounts. Automation and integrations are supported through an API surface that lets teams sync events and audience logic with external systems.
A key tradeoff is governance overhead for teams that do not have a clear event taxonomy and identification strategy. For example, early implementations can produce noisy segments when event naming and user identification are not standardized. Pendo fits best when in-app messaging needs to reflect behavioral conditions and when product analytics is already a shared workflow with engineering and enablement.

Smartlook
SMBBehavioral analytics and session recording platform for web and mobile applications.
Privacy-safe session replays integrated with identity stitching so later known users map back to earlier anonymous sessions.
Smartlook records privacy-safe session replays and pairs them with event timelines for faster root-cause analysis. Event tracking covers funnel analysis, path exploration, and cohort-style views, with segmentation driven by event properties. Identity stitching links anonymous activity to later sign-ins so support and product debugging do not restart at each visit.
A key tradeoff is that deeper event taxonomy control depends on disciplined naming and property standards, because analytics accuracy follows event consistency. Smartlook fits teams that already have a strong front-end instrumentation story and want replay and behavioral analytics tied together for iterative UX fixes.

Behavioral analytics software captures product and digital events, then analyzes behavior through funnels, pathing, and cohort retention to isolate where users drop off and why. Tools like Mixpanel pair event streams with segmentation and retention reporting, so behavioral conditions can feed analysis and downstream automation.
Many deployments also add session replay to reduce ambiguity when a funnel step looks wrong. Smartlook ties privacy-safe session replay to identity stitching so anonymous behavior can map forward to known users, which makes replay evidence usable inside later analytics workflows.

Common implementation pitfalls that break funnels, cohorts, and replay correlation
Most deployment failures come from mismatched expectations about how much event and identity discipline is required. Several tools degrade quickly when event taxonomy and property naming are inconsistent across teams.
Other failures come from overusing visual evidence without making it traceable back to the specific funnel steps or segment conditions that drove the analysis.
Relying on funnels and cohorts without enforcing consistent event taxonomy and properties
Mixpanel depends on consistent event taxonomy for analytics quality, so inconsistent naming can break funnel and segment accuracy. Amplitude has the same failure mode because behavioral cohorting and retention curves become misleading when taxonomy governance is weak.
Treating replay as a standalone view instead of a replay-to-event or replay-to-step workflow
Crazy Egg can deliver fast URL-scoped visual diagnostics, but it does not provide deep identity stitching for complex journeys. Quantum Metric and Smartlook align replay evidence to funnel steps or identity continuity, which prevents investigations from stalling on unrelated sessions.
Starting automation or in-app targeting before identification and segmentation logic stabilizes
Pendo’s in-app targeting depends on segment rules driven by behavior, so early segment logic mistakes create incorrect contextual UI. Mixpanel automation rules depend on behavioral conditions from funnels, retention, and segments, so unstable event instrumentation can trigger wrong automation paths.
Allowing governance gaps to create data sprawl across replays and analytics workspaces
Smartlook requires careful workspace configuration for advanced governance to avoid data sprawl when replay and analytics views expand. Quantum Metric’s event model tuning can become heavy when analytics ownership is missing, which increases drift risk across teams.
Ignoring replay performance constraints on highly interactive pages
Mouseflow can see replay performance degrade on pages with heavy client-side activity, which can reduce the usefulness of replay evidence for funnel debugging. Teams that focus on rapid visual triage should validate heatmap and replay behavior on the highest-traffic pages before rolling out broadly.
